On Monday morning, a large-scale search operation is underway on Lake Chiemsee in Germany, following the report of an 85-year-old surfer missing since Sunday afternoon.
The water rescue service, fire brigades, and police are working together in the search, utilising a boat, sonar technology, and even a helicopter to scour the lake and its surroundings. The surfboard of the missing man was discovered on Sunday evening, but there has been no sign or contact with him as yet.
